Einzelnen Beitrag anzeigen

axellang

Registriert seit: 3. Mai 2003
Ort: München
138 Beiträge
 
Delphi XE2 Enterprise
 
#3

AW: Benötige Hilfe bei TPageProducer

  Alt 3. Sep 2014, 18:37
@Jumpy

Ja verstehe,

es geht nicht um das DatenModul sondern um den doppelten Aufruf.
Das DatenModul kann er zig mal erstellen, das macht nichts. Das Problem besteht darin,
das der PP alle Tags doppelt durchläuft.

Wenn der PP auf den ersten Tag trifft, ruft er eine Methode im DatenModul auf und füllt mit den erhaltenen Daten
den Tag, z.B. TAG1. das geht ja in Ordnung. Das macht der auch mit dem zweiten Tag TAG2 und das ist auch
im Sinn des Erfinders. So nun hat er alle Tags im HTML-Template durchlaufen und jedem Tag seinen Wert
zugewiesen. Ob der das in einer Schleife macht oder wie auch immer, das ist nebensächlich.

Von mir aus kann er nochmals das Dokument parsen, ob ein Tag vergessen wurde, auch Ok, aber der PageProducer
ruft jeden Tag nochmals auf und verpasst ihm den Wert erneut egal ob schon geschehen oder nicht.

So als mache er erst mal einen Probelauf um dann im zweiten Anlauf die Werte nochmals einzutragen.

Leider finde ich nirgends eine gute Doku darüber.

Deshalb meine Frage:

Mache ich selbst was falsch?
Falls ja, wie benutzt man die Komponente richtig.
Oder, oder....

Danke, Alexander
Alexander Lang
  Mit Zitat antworten Zitat